2002 SESSION
SB 179 Conservators of the peace.
Introduced by: Malfourd W. Trumbo |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S PASSED: (all summaries)
Conservators of the peace; Department of Professional and Occupational Regulation. Designates as conservators of the peace investigators of the Criminal Investigation section of the Department of Professional and Occupational Regulation. The bill also creates a registry of all conservators of the peace with the Department of State Police. The bill has a delayed effective date of July 1, 2003.
